Senior Data Engineer - Data Pipelines
Own the full lifecycle of large-scale data pipelines, from design to production, across multiple regions. Build and optimize distributed processing jobs, evolve data models, and ensure data quality and observability. Mentor engineers and drive engineering rigor through design reviews, code review, and automation.
Responsibilities
- Design, build, and maintain scalable data pipelines running in multiple regions
- Write and optimize large-scale distributed processing jobs using PySpark on EMR or Databricks
- Evolve data models and pipelines feeding threat intelligence, assets, and detections product layers
- Design and implement data quality frameworks (e.g., Great Expectations) for health checks and conditional monitoring
- Establish and lead observability across all pipelines with distributed tracing, structured logging, and metrics
- Set technical direction for pipeline infrastructure and drive automation of operational tasks
- Conduct design reviews, code reviews, and mentorship to raise overall engineering standards
Requirements
- 7+ years building and operating production data pipelines at scale, including system design and operation
- Deep Python 3.10+ expertise (Pydantic, async, decorators, packaging, profiling)
- Production experience with Apache Airflow at scale: DAG authoring, dynamic task mapping, MWAA or self-hosted
- PySpark mastery: job authoring, optimization (partitioning, shuffle mitigation, join strategies, Catalyst plans), EMR or Databricks
- Snowflake depth: Snowpark, schema/clustering design, query tuning, warehouse sizing, cost attribution
- AWS knowledge: S3, SQS/SNS, EMR, IAM, infrastructure-as-code
- Data quality framework design experience (e.g., Great Expectations) beyond configuration
- Observability tooling: distributed tracing, structured logging, metrics
- CI/CD with artifact packaging and staged deployments across environments and regions
- Strong testing discipline: pytest, moto, integration tests against cloud services
